goEast Film Festival wraps 25th anniversary with awards and new leadership
The 25th anniversary edition of goEast – Festival of Central and Eastern European Film concluded in Wiesbaden with Holy Electricity (GEO, NLD 2024) by Tato Kotetishvili winning the prestigious Golden Lily for Best Film. The jury, chaired by director Jasmila Žbanić, praised its vivid cinematography and subtle humour, awarding the top prize along with €10,000.
